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423364964 1366804766 905973 47628616677
411985801 30194968787
411985801 30194968787
7962863 2533 81806
All about undefined
Interested in learning more?
411985801 30194968787
7962863 2533 81806
See more
292498 49573996
4776 89571 64698828
See more
23 19096
042651305 179571616 5422
See more